Summary

VAN LOTT, INC has accumulated 24 OSHA violations across 2 inspections over 22 years of recorded history, with $3,775 in total assessed penalties.

The establishment sits in the 96th percentile for violations within its industry-state peer group of 582 employers. Inspection frequency runs at the 73rd percentile. The most recent enforcement activity was recorded 18 years ago.
